1. Preparing the Chicken
Begin extract by prepping your chicken. Take your two boneless, skinless chicken breasts and pat them thoroughly dry with paper towels. This step is crucial for achieving a nice sear. Season both sides generously with salt and pepper. Now, you have two options for cooking the chicken: you can either cut them into bite-sized pieces (about 1-inch cubes) for quicker cooking and easier eating, or you can cook them whole and slice them later. If you’re cutting them into pieces, do it now. If you prefer them whole, just proceed to the next step.
2. Searing the Chicken and Making the Sauce
Heat the olive oil in a large skillet or frying pan over medium-high heat. Once the oil is shimmering, carefully add the chicken pieces (or whole breasts). Sear the chicken until golden brown on all sides. This usually takes about 3-4 minutes per side if cut into pieces, or about 5-6 minutes per side if cooking whole. Don’t overcrowd the pan; cook in batches if necessary to ensure a good sear. Once the chicken is nicely browned, remove it from the skillet and set it aside on a plate. Now, reduce the heat to medium. In the same skillet, add the honey, soy sauce, apple cider vinegar, ground black p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and cayenne pepper. Whisk everything together until well combined. Let this sauce simmer gently for about 2-3 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ld and the sauce to slightly thicken. This is where all the magic happens!
3. Finishing the Chicken
Return the seared chicken (cut into pieces or whole breasts) to the skillet with the simmering sauce. If you cooked the chicken whole, make sure to turn them to coat them evenly in the sauce. Continue to cook for another 5-8 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the sauce has thickened further, beautifully coating the chicken. If you cut the chicken into pieces, it will likely cook through completely in this step. If you cooked them whole, you can now remove them from the skillet, slice them against the grain into desired thickness, and then return them to the sauce to coat. The sauce should be glossy and slightly sticky, clingin extractg to every piece of chicken.
4. Cooking the Macaroni
While the chicken is simmering, it’s time to get the macaroni going. Bring a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. Add the 8 ounces of macaroni pasta and cook according to the package directions until al dente. This means it should be tender but still have a slight bite to it. Once the pasta is cooked, drain it thoroughly in a colander. Don’t rinse the pasta; the starch helps the sauce adhere beautifully.
5. Making the Creamy Cheese Sauce
In the same pot you used for the pasta (no need to wash it!), melt the 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at. Once the butter is melted and slightly foamy, whisk in the 2 tablespoons of all-purpose flour. Cook this mixture, stirring constantly, for about 1-2 minutes. This is your roux, and cooking it slightly helps to remove the raw flour taste. Gradually whisk in the 2 cups of milk, a little at a time, ensuring each addition is incorporated before adding more. Continue to cook, stirring frequently, until the sauce begin extracts to thicken. This should take about 5-7 minutes. Once the sauce is smooth and has reached a thick, creamy consistency, remove the pot from the heat. Stir in the 2 cups of shredded sharp cheddar cheese until it’s completely melted and the sauce is smooth and luscious. Season with a little salt and pepper to taste, if needed, but the cheese is usually salty enough.
6. Combining and Serving
Now for the grand finnon-alcoholic ale! Add the drained macaroni pasta directly into the pot with the cheese sauce. Stir gently until all the pasta is evenly coated in the glorious, creamy cheese sauce. To serve, spoon a generous portion of the creamy macaroni and cheese onto each plate. Top with the glorious sweet and spicy honey pepper chicken. Garnish with a sprinkle of fresh parsley if you have some on hand, though it’s absolutely delicious without it. Frequently Asked Questions:
How can I adjust the spice level?
For less spice, reduce the amount of black pepper or opt for a milder chili flake. If you want it even spicier, feel free to add more chili flakes or a pinch of cayenne pepper to the sauce.
What other proteins can I use with this sauce?
This versatile sauce works wonderfully with other proteins! Try it with beef tenderloin, shrimp, tofu, or even thinly sliced beef. Adjust cooking times accordingly.
Can I make this ahead of time?
While it’s best enjoyed fresh for maximum flavor, you can prepare the sauce a day in advance and store it in the refrigerator. You can also pre-cut your chicken. Reheat the sauce gently before tossing with the cooked chicken.

Sweet and Spicy Honey Pepper Chicken with Macaroni and Cheese
A delicious and easy recipe for tender chicken breasts coated in a sweet and spicy honey pepper sauce, served with creamy homemade macaroni and cheese.
Ingredients
-
2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
-
Salt and pepper to taste
-
1 tablespoon olive oil
-
1/2 cup honey
-
1/4 cup soy sauce
-
1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
-
1 teaspoon ground black pepper
-
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
-
1/2 teaspoon onion powder
-
1/4 teaspoon ground cayenne pepper
-
8 ounces elbow macaroni pasta
-
2 tablespoons butter
-
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
-
2 cups milk
-
2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
Instructions
-
Step 1
Pat chicken breasts dry and season with salt and pepper. Cut into bite-sized pieces. -
Step 2
In a bowl, whisk together honey, soy sauce, apple cider vinegar, ground black p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and cayenne pepper to make the sauce. -
Step 3
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ken and cook until brow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es. -
Step 4
Pour the honey pepper sauce over the cooked chicken in the skillet. Simmer for 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ens and coats the chicken. -
Step 5
While the chicken simmers, cook the macaroni pasta according to package directions. Drain and set aside. -
Step 6
In a separate sa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Whisk in flour and cook for 1 minute. -
Step 7
Gradually whisk in milk until smooth. Bring to a simmer and cook, stirring, until thickened, about 5 minutes. -
Step 8
Remove from heat and stir in shredded cheddar cheese until melted and sm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ste. -
Step 9
Add the cooked macaroni to the cheese sauce and stir to combine. Serve the honey pepper chicken over the macaroni and cheese.
